Neward's article is here: http://blogs.tedneward.com/2006/06/26/The+Vietnam+Of+Compute... There is a post elsewhere on HN that links to the wrong article. You have to skip forward a bit to get beyond the history of the Vietnam War to get to the meat. The gist of the post is that there is a fundamental impedance mismatch between OO and Relational. If you try to apply inheritance to relational databases you get an unholy quagmire. My experience is that this is true. You get a rat's nest of tables and unwieldy joins. There are more problems with schema ownership, dual schemas, and refactoring. Coding Horror lifts the summary and leaves behind all the argument |
